Title: Corporal Cannon Author: Savannah Cannon Narrator: Savannah Cannon Format: mp3 Length: 8 hrs and 43 mins Release date: 10-18-22 Ratings: 5 out of 5 stars, 33 ratings Genres: Military & War Publisher's Summary: Not even old enough to drink, Corporal Savannah Cannon is a young enlisted United States Marine deployed to support Operation Enduring Freedom in Afghanistan in 2010. As a tactical data networking specialist, she is sent away from everyone she knows and attached to a Regimental Combat Team where women are not allowed to repair communications. Her experiences over the next few months shed light on the unique and difficult positions women are placed in when supporting combat roles, while offering a raw look at the painful choices women must sometimes make.
